ABOUT · EST. 2018
Our mission is to help the world make the most of PostgreSQL.
In 2018 this was one DBA's private toolbox — a pile of scripts for running PostgreSQL properly. It went open source in 2020, grew into the Pigsty distribution, then a package manager, a metrics exporter, and the public repositories and extension catalog the wider ecosystem runs on.
Along the way we raised a second flag: Silo, the PIGSTY-maintained fork of MinIO — S3-compatible object storage with ongoing security updates, a working console, and full release artifacts still shipping, now at 2.0k stars. Keeping alive a project its upstream set down is as real a contribution as writing a new one. The toolbox became an ecosystem, and behind its author now stands a company: PGSTY.
THE MISSING i
Pigsty started as an acronym: PostgreSQL In Great STYle — six letters, PIGSTY. When the time came to register a company, we wrote down five: PGSTY. Not a typo. We took one letter out on purpose.
The missing i is Infrastructure: the global package repository at repo.pigsty.io and its mainland-China mirror repo.pigsty.cc, offline packages pinned to exact OS minor versions, and the extension catalog at pgext.cloud — 2,230 extensions catalogued, 562 packaged and ready to install. None of it asks for an account, a license key, or a sales call.
We run this layer as a public utility for the whole ecosystem, not as a perk for our customers — because ecosystem continuity is itself infrastructure. Databases outlive vendors, and a community that lives on packages deserves repositories that stay up.
So that is the story the name tells: the product keeps its six letters, the company works with five. The i is the letter we gave away — free for everyone, forever.
